#  Purnati Khuntia, PhD 

Mechano-Developmental Biology

Our lab investigates how tissue-level architectures emerge from the material properties and spatial organization of subcellular structures. Currently, we are focusing on nuclear mechanics and positioning in the context of epithelial pseudostratification. By using a diverse set of model organisms, we aim to uncover fundamental principles governing how nuclear material properties contribute to the evolution of pseudostratified architecture. With state-of-the-art high-resolution microscopy and mechanical as well as molecular perturbations, we aim to recapitulate the evolutionary trajectory of pseudostratification as a function of nuclear mechanics.
